Muxtape Monday: At Your Convenience

At Your Convenience. This muxtape is the second in an ongoing series of posts, the eight songs I chose are ones that I feel represent a sort of slowed and relaxed state that I tend to find myself in. Otherwise, it’s a relatively unorganized collection of good music. Enjoy.

Radiohead - Like Spinning
PlatesPortishead - Silence
Beirut - Scenic World
Bowerbirds - Hooves
Menomena - The Pelican
Gotye - Hearts A Mess
Beasts and Superbeasts - If I Was A House
Moby - Now I Can Let It Go

Muxtape Monday is a bi-monthly feature in which I provide a musical playlist containing a selection of music that has to do with various themes, ideas, etc. The framework established by the creators of Muxtape allows only twelve songs to be uploaded at any one time, therefore, each playlist will only be available for 2 weeks.
